Output f8d114655b5bf0b563a01c3fe827e8513d5262a6cfa082fe5abdc1992bc9bda8:3

value
682579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ab811afef51d1347660bc3326868c5b4d8ea8c3a OP_EQUAL
address
3HKr8kWDWffUGimrgwXmVxmNuiJiUZ5VaY
transaction
f8d114655b5bf0b563a01c3fe827e8513d5262a6cfa082fe5abdc1992bc9bda8
spent
true